The Challenges of Trusting AI in Autonomous Driving

As autonomous driving technology advances, trusting AI remains a significant challenge. With its current limitations in decision-making and understanding, the quest for reliable self-driving cars raises important questions about safety and accountability.

In a world where technology seems to advance at the speed of light, one would think that by now we’d have conquered the art of autonomous driving.

After all, artificial intelligence (AI) has been around longer than many of us have been alive.

Yet, as I sit here contemplating the intricacies of AI and its shortcomings, I’m reminded that despite its 73 years of existence, AI still can’t drive a car with the finesse of a human being.

The crux of the matter is not just about the technological gadgets or the sensors that are supposedly the eyes and ears of these autonomous vehicles.

It’s much deeper than that.

It’s about the very essence of how AI “thinks”—or more accurately, how little we understand its thought processes.

AI chatbots, for instance, have been known to hallucinate and even lie about simple math problems.

A friend of mine, experimenting with ChatGPT, asked it to solve “57+92,” and while it got the answer right, its explanation of the process was akin to a child trying to bluff their way through a math test.

This raises an intriguing question: if AI struggles with basic arithmetic truthfulness, how can we trust it with the complexities of driving?

Driving is not just about following a set of instructions or reacting to stimuli; it involves intuition, ethical decision-making, and sometimes split-second judgments that can mean the difference between life and death.

While we humans have honed our reflexes and decision-making over millennia, AI is still in its infancy in these respects.

The recent findings from Anthropic’s tests on language models like Claude suggest that AI might create logic to fit preconceived narratives.

In real-world terms, imagine an AI trying to justify its decisions on the road to align with the expectations of its creators or users.

It’s a fascinating yet slightly unnerving thought: the possibility of AI cars making decisions based not on the best course of action, but on what they think we want them to do.

This smacks of a robotic politician—a being that operates not on principles but on placating its audience.

Despite these hurdles, the race to develop fully autonomous vehicles continues.

The allure of a future where cars drive us, rather than the other way around, is too strong to resist.

Yet, in this race, we must remember that we are not just building machines; we are creating entities that mimic human-like decision-making.

AI’s inability to process multi-sensory inputs as adeptly as humans is another significant roadblock.

Nature has perfected the art of synthesizing various sensory inputs into coherent actions—a feat that AI has yet to achieve.

Until it can, AI will remain the perpetual learner, lagging behind its human teachers.

However, there’s a silver lining.

The fact that we don’t fully understand AI’s cognitive processes may eventually become its greatest strength.

It could evolve in unexpected ways, potentially surpassing human capabilities in certain areas, including driving.

But for now, as we venture further into the realm of AI, one thing remains clear: we must tread carefully, ensuring that the AI of tomorrow is not only more capable but also more honest.

After all, the last thing we need is a fleet of autonomous vehicles embroiled in debates over culpability.

As we continue to innovate, let’s hope that we can instill a sense of integrity in our AI creations, sparing us from a future of robotic blame games.
